解釋影響物理資料庫設計(物理資料庫設計因素)的因素


物理資料庫設計用於在資料儲存結構化過程中提高效能。

影響物理資料庫設計的因素

讓我們看看影響物理資料庫設計的重要因素:

事務和查詢

瞭解將執行哪些型別的事務和查詢以及資料庫將用於什麼用途非常重要。

需要以下關於**查詢**的資訊:

  • 查詢將訪問的檔案。

  • 為查詢指定的篩選條件。

  • 在查詢中使用的篩選條件型別,例如相等、範圍或不等。

  • 在查詢中使用的連線條件。

  • 為了查詢最佳化而連線表的必要性。

需要以下關於**事務**的資訊:

  • 要更新的檔案。

  • 對檔案執行的操作型別。

  • 將應用條件的屬性。

  • 將修改其資料的屬性。

頻率分析

在確定要執行的查詢和事務的特性和特徵後,重要的是要找到每個查詢/事務的呼叫頻率。此資訊有助於編譯每個查詢/事務的預期頻率列表。

時間限制

許多查詢/事務都提供效能限制。可能需要幾秒鐘才能終止。這些限制會優先考慮索引的候選屬性。具有時間限制的查詢中使用的屬性具有最高優先順序。

更新頻率

如果定期更新檔案,則必須具有一定數量的訪問路徑。這是因為整個活動會減慢操作速度。

唯一性約束

每個候選鍵屬性都應該有一個索引。當檢查唯一性約束時,索引使搜尋更容易。這是因為所有屬性值都存在於索引的葉節點中。

更新於:2021年7月8日

1K+ 瀏覽量

啟動您的職業生涯

透過完成課程獲得認證

開始
廣告
© . All rights reserved.